Output 7ed84f2d846027fa68ae4978f2f1d4d297bbab34faeb14494ca08c62e6151ae2:2

value
23364740
script pubkey
OP_0 OP_PUSHBYTES_20 30d91f8474efae2d448088d96e18452ca30c3591
address
bc1qxrv3lpr5a7hz63yq3rvkuxz99j3scdv32pgx82
transaction
7ed84f2d846027fa68ae4978f2f1d4d297bbab34faeb14494ca08c62e6151ae2
spent
true